Paver Flooring Installation in Boulder, CO
Paver flooring installation services provide a durable and attractive option for outdoor surfaces such as patios, walkways, driveways, and pool decks. This service involves laying interlocking or individual pavers made from materials like concrete, brick, or natural stone to create a customized and long-lasting surface. Property owners often request paver installation for its versatility, aesthetic appeal, and ability to withstand weather conditions, making it a popular choice for enhancing outdoor living spaces and improving curb appeal.
Before requesting paver flooring installation, property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the space, the type of materials preferred, and the existing landscape or surface conditions. It is also helpful to understand the scope of the project, including the size of the area, drainage requirements, and any necessary preparation work like excavation or base leveling. Clarifying these details can ensure the selected design and materials meet the specific needs and expectations for the property.

Paver Flooring Installation Questions
What types of projects are suitable for paver flooring installation? Paver flooring is ideal for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or living spaces, providing dur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long does paver flooring typ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, paver flooring can last several decades, making it a long-lasting choice for outdoor surfaces.
What materials are commonly used for paver flooring?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different styles and textures to match property designs.
Is paver flooring suitable for uneven ground? Yes, paver installations can be adapted to uneven surfaces through proper grading and base preparation to ensure stability and appearance.
